The Impact of Physical Therapy on Functional Outcomes in Children with Relapsed Clubfoot

Abstract

The Ponseti method is effective in treating clubfoot, but recurrence of the deformity occurs in 26% to 48% of children. Serial casting and surgery are common methods for treating relapsed clubfoot, but physical therapy (PT) may offer a more conservative treatment option. Our aim is to assess the impact of PT on foot passive range of motion (PROM), gait pattern, and gross motor function in children with relapsed clubfoot.

This study included a convenience sample of ambulatory children diagnosed with clubfoot who were initially treated with the Ponseti method but had recurrence of clubfoot. In this IRB-approved retrospective study, children completed a PT episode that addressed stretching, strengthening, and gross motor skills. Flexibility/foot position was assessed with ankle dorsiflexion, forefoot abduction PROM, and Pirani/Böhm/Sinclair (PBS) Scores. Functional outcomes included single limb stance time, single hop length, broad jump length, and observational gait score. To determine long term effectiveness of PT, the need for foot surgery after PT discharge was obtained from the medical record. Differences between initial PT evaluation and PT discharge evaluation were analyzed using paired t-tests or Wilcoxon signed-rank tests, as appropriate.

After PT, all outcome measures showed statistically significant improvement (p<0.05). Following an average of 7±3 years after PT discharge, 67% of children required surgical intervention to correct persistent clubfoot deformities. PT can effectively reduce foot deformities and improve functional outcomes in children with recurrent clubfoot despite the need for surgery for definitive correction in many cases.
